Audio Samples of Common Horse Sounds

Listen to audio recordings of horse sounds, including a whinny, nicker, blow and squeal. From the editors of EQUUS magazine.

In the July 2006 issue of EQUUS, an article by Jennifer Williams, PhD, called “What’s Your Horse Telling You?” describes common horse sounds and what they mean. Here are audio recordings (.mp3 files) of several of those sounds.
